According to the public record, 5, Queens Close, Kenilworth is a mid-century freehold house with 1,097 ft2 of internal area and sits on a 355 m2 plot.
Houses of this size in this area normally have 3 bedrooms with a garden.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for 5, Queens Close, Kenilworth is £428,879 and the estimated rental value is £1,829 per month.
Queens Close, Kenilworth, CV8 is located in the borough of Warwick within the CV8 postal district.
5, Queens Close, Kenilworth has 3 entries in the Land Registry , most recently in May 2024 and a single entry in the EPC database dated February 2019.

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 5, Queens Close, Kenilworth is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£450,323 and a rental value of £1,920 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£398,857 and a rental value of £1,701 per month.
Over the last 12 months the sale value of 5 Queens Close Kenilworth has increased by an estimated £1,447 (0.3%) and its rental value has increased by an estimated £46 per month (2.5%), giving an expected gross yield of 5.1%.

5, Queens Close, Kenilworth has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of D.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 27 Feb 2019.
The property is connected to mains gas and has mostly double glazing.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
According to HM Land Registry, 5, Queens Close, Kenilworth was last sold on 17th May 2024 for £440,000 and was recorded as a freehold house.
The property has had 3 sales since 1995.
Since May 2024, the market for similar properties has risen 20.9%
According to the Land Registry and our network of Estate Agents, there have been 3 sales of properties similar to 5, Queens Close, Kenilworth within a radius of 510 metres over the last 2 years.
The most recent example is 7, Queens Close, Kenilworth, CV8 1JR, a freehold house which sold for £370,000 on the 4th February 2025.
